INXS are an Australian rock band formed in Sydney in 1977, fronted by Michael Hutchence until his death in 1997. They achieved international success in the 1980s, most famously with the 1987 album Kick.

Best-known songs include Need You Tonight, Devil Inside, New Sensation and Never Tear Us Apart; signature album Kick (1987) consolidated their international fame.
